c. BUSINESS LICENSE: The applicant shall secure an approved Business License prior to the <br /> initiation of the use. The Business License may be applied for concurrently with the building permit <br /> application. (Section 7-1000 of the County Ordinance Code) <br /> d. STORM DRAINAGE: Storm water drainage shall be retained on-site. .The drainage pattern and . <br /> corresponding storm drain improvements shall be shown on the Site Plan. Drainage calculations <br /> prepared by a registered civil engineer or architect shall be included. (Development Title Section 9- <br /> 1135) <br /> e. PARKING: Off-street parking shall be provided and comply with the following: <br /> (1) All parking spaces, driveways, and maneuvering areas shall be surfaced and permanently <br /> maintained with base material of appropriate depth and asphalt concrete or Portland cement <br /> concrete to provide a durable, dust free surface. Bumper guards shall be provided where <br /> necessary to protect adjacent structures or properties. (Development Title Section 9-1015.5[e]) <br /> (2) A minimum of four (4) parking spaces shall be provided, including one accessible space which <br /> shall be van accessible. Accessible spaces shall be located as close as possible to the primary <br /> entrance (C C.R., Title 24). <br /> f. LANDSCAPING: Landscaping shall be provided and comply with the following: <br /> (1) A minimum ten (10) foot wide landscaped strip, respecting the ultimate right-of-way width of <br /> Glasscock Road and State Route 12, shall be installed. (Development Title Section 9-1020.7) <br /> (2) All areas not used for buildings, parking, driveways, walkways, approved outdoor storage areas, <br /> or other permanent facilities shall be landscaped. (Development Title Section 9-1020.7) <br /> (3) Areas of the property which are not part of the project shall be barricaded from traffic and kept <br /> mowed and dust free. <br /> g. SIGNS: Sign details shall be consistent with Chapter 9-1710 of the Development Title and be <br /> included on the Site Plan. All portions of any sign shall be set back a minimum of five (5) feet from <br /> any future right-of-way line, including any corner cut-off (snipe). (Development Title Section 9- <br /> 1710.2[g]) <br /> h. LOSS OF AGRICULTURAL LAND: The applicant shall provide mitigation for the loss of agricultural <br /> land by providing $$200 per acre to Reclamation District 548 prior to issuance of building permits. <br /> i. SCREENING: Screening shall be provided and comply with the following: <br /> (1) All storage materials and related activities, including storage areas for trash, shall be screened <br /> so as not to be visible from adjacent properties and public rights-of-way. Screening shall be six <br /> (6)to seven (7)feet in height. Outside storage is not permitted in front yards, street side yards, or <br /> in front of main buildings. (Development Title Section 1022.4[d][21) <br /> j.
